x(x-2)=7568
We move all terms to the left:
x(x-2)-(7568)=0
We multiply parentheses
x^2-2x-7568=0
a = 1; b = -2; c = -7568;
Δ = b2-4ac
Δ = -22-4·1·(-7568)
Δ = 30276
The delta value is higher than zero, so the equation has two solutions
We use following formulas to calculate our solutions:$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}$$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}$$\sqrt{\Delta}=\sqrt{30276}=174$$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}=\frac{-(-2)-174}{2*1}=\frac{-172}{2} =-86 $$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}=\frac{-(-2)+174}{2*1}=\frac{176}{2} =88 $
